Error code: XM NO SIGNAL or XM LOADING is displayed (with navigation)

NOTE:
- Check the vehicle battery condition first (see BATTERY TEST ).
- Check the connectors for poor connection or loose terminals.
- Check for other error codes (see XM SELF-DIAGNOSIS ), and check the XM Antenna Signal Reception Level (see XM SIGNAL RECEPTION LEVEL INDICATION MODE ).
- Park the vehicle outside with a clear view of the southern horizon.
- Turn the ignition switch to ON (II).
- Turn on the audio-navigation unit, and select XM radio.
Does the XM radio receive a signal?
YES -Reception operation is normal.
NO -Go to step 4.
-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0).
- Check the connection at XM antenna 2P connector and AcuraLink control unit (XM receiver) connector B (2P).
Are the connectors connected?
YES -Go to step 6.
NO -Reconnect the XM antenna 2P connector and AcuraLink control unit connector B (2P) connector, and recheck XM radio operation. If the signal is restored, the system is OK. If the signal is not restored, go to step 6.
- Substitute a known-good XM antenna (see XM ANTENNA REPLACEMENT
).
Does the XM radio receive a signal?
YES -Replace the original XM antenna (see XM ANTENNA REPLACEMENT ).
NO -
- With AcuraLink: Substitute a known-good XM antenna lead. If the AcuraLink control unit (XM receiver) receives a signal, replace the original XM antenna lead. If the AcuraLink control unit (XM receiver) does not receive a signal, substitute a known-good AcuraLink control unit (XM receiver) (see ACURALINK CONTROL UNIT (XM RECEIVER) REMOVAL/INSTALLATION ), and recheck. If the symptom/indication goes away, replace the original AcuraLink control unit (XM receiver) (see ACURALINK CONTROL UNIT (XM RECEIVER) REMOVAL/INSTALLATION ).
- Without AcuraLink: Substitute a known-good XM antenna lead. If the XM receiver receives signal, replace the original XM antenna lead. If the XM receiver does not receive signal, substitute a known-good XM receiver unit (see ACURALINK CONTROL UNIT (XM RECEIVER) REMOVAL/INSTALLATION0 ), and recheck. If the symptom/indication goes away, replace the original XM receiver unit (see ACURALINK CONTROL UNIT (XM RECEIVER) REMOVAL/INSTALLATION0 ).
